Study Summary
The purpose of this study is to determine the effect of dietary fat, in standard formulation, on the composition of the human microbiome in a prospective study of normal volunteers. Participants will be randomly assigned to either a high fat or low fat diet for 10 days. The gut microbiome will be phylotyped in fecal samples as well as in bacteria adherent to the colonic mucosa prior to, and during the course of the dietary interventions.
Interventions
- OTHER High fat diet
